JQuery将相同名称的元素的值放到一个数组内,JQuery判断数组是否包含某个元素

JQuery数组操作及元素判断
博客介绍了JQuery的数组操作,包括将相同名称元素的值放入数组,以及判断数组是否包含某个元素,还提及了$.inArray( value, array [, fromIndex ] ) 这一知识点。

JQuery将相同名称的元素的值放到一个数组内:

var list = new Array();
$("input[name='ids']").each(function() {
	list.push($(this).val());
});
console.log(list);

//日志输出
/*["052699f3-5556-48d4-bf2e-34fea094a05e", "19329a9e-f1bd-495b-b646-328bc922e7bd"]*/

JQuery判断数组是否包含某个元素:

知识点:$.inArray( value, array [, fromIndex ] ) ,其中

value任意类型 用于查找的值。
arrayArray类型 指定被查找的数组。
fromIndex可选。Number类型 指定从数组的指定索引位置开始查找,默认为 0
var arr = $.inArray("id", list);
console.log(arr);
if (arr < 0) {
   //元素不存在
}else{
   //元素存在
}

 

点此欢迎光临我的个人网站【一几文星球】

微信公众号,欢迎关注,一起学习。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

一几文

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值